I am designing a form and am struggling with implementing a if then javascript statement and am curious if there is anything this community can help me with. Here is the scenario.
I have a drop down list called park1.
I have a numerical field called possible1.
I would like to set the dropdown, and based on what the option in the drop down is, have the possible field auto populate with a value.
Here is my javascript code, which I can find no errors in.
So if the first option, or the drop down option with a value of 1 is set in park1, it should populate possible1 with 40. and so on.
All I get when I implement this on the possible1 field, is a blank white box for possible1. It never changes and is not fillable.
Any help is appreciated. I feel like i am missing something very simple here.

I have accomplished this using a different javascript (change event of the droplist):
if (xfa.event.newText=="1")
{possible1.rawValue="40"
}
if (xfa.event.newText=="2")
{possible1.rawValue="40"
}
if (xfa.event.newText=="3")
{possible1.rawValue="35"
}
And so on.
